25 #include "qemu/osdep.h"
26 #include "util.h"
27 
28 int net_parse_macaddr(uint8_t *macaddr, const char *p)
29 {
30     int i;
31     char *last_char;
32     long int offset;
33 
34     errno = 0;
35     offset = strtol(p, &last_char, 0);
36     if (errno == 0 && *last_char == '\0' &&
37         offset >= 0 && offset <= 0xFFFFFF) {
38         macaddr[3] = (offset & 0xFF0000) >> 16;
39         macaddr[4] = (offset & 0xFF00) >> 8;
40         macaddr[5] = offset & 0xFF;
41         return 0;
42     }
43 
44     for (i = 0; i < 6; i++) {
45         macaddr[i] = strtol(p, (char **)&p, 16);
46         if (i == 5) {
47             if (*p != '\0') {
48                 return -1;
49             }
50         } else {
51             if (*p != ':' && *p != '-') {
52                 return -1;
53             }
54             p++;
55         }
56     }
57 
58     return 0;
59 }
